Transaction d426d112eb03acc0a65e76864b3fd792396438f0c032e9ee08e5c3cbbfa24a39
1 Input
1 Output
-
d426d112eb03acc0a65e76864b3fd792396438f0c032e9ee08e5c3cbbfa24a39:0
- value
- 1029486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cc07949163632aa7a92433f01f0c62d107f0114 OP_EQUAL
- address
- 3EXF6iFmfwwL89APC5vGbVq2fRSpLqEJTT